PandaDoc is seeking a Senior Python Engineer to join their Customer Value track. The successful candidate will collaborate with engineers, product managers, and designers to create positive customer impact, write clean and testable code, and follow a feature through its entire lifetime.
Requirements
- At least 5+ years of development experience with Python
- Experience with the Django framework
- Experience with microservice-based architectures
- Experience with relational databases (SQL queries, migrations, optimization)
- Experience with message queues (e.g., RabbitMQ, NATS, Kafka)
- Strong communicator
- Experience in software and API design
- Ability to communicate effectively in English, both spoken and written
- Willingness to write in Java (10% of tasks)
- Willingness to engage and contribute with frontend projects
Benefits
- An honest, open culture that emphasizes feedback and promotes professional and personal development
- An opportunity to work from anywhere
- 6 self care days
- A competitive salary
- Much more!